#a7c4bb basic color information

#a7c4bb

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#a7c4bb has decimal index of: 10994875, is composed of 65.5% red, 76.9% green and 73.3% blue. #a7c4bb in CMYK color model, is composed of 14.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.6% yellow and 23.1% black.
#99cccc is the closest web-safe color to #a7c4bb.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
